Проблемы с jQuery .wrap() и IE7/8

Я пытаюсь проверить, есть ли у изображения класс, если оно имеет = Wrap, как это, иначе = Wrap, как это. Он отлично работает во всех браузерах, кроме ie7 и ie8.

Мой код выглядит так:

$('.node-blogginl-gg img').each(function() {
    imgurl = $(this).attr('src').replace('http://www.safsen.se/sites/safsen/files/styles/bloggbild/public/', 'http://www.safsen.se/sites/safsen/files/');
                if($(this).hasClass("centerImg")){
                    $(this).wrap('<div class="centerImage"><a rel="prettyPhoto[bloggbilder]" href="' + imgurl + '">');
                }else {
                    $(this).wrap('<a href="' + imgurl + '" rel="prettyPhoto[bloggbilder]">');
                }

        });

Есть идеи?

0 ответов

Другие вопросы по тегам